A Senior Signalling Installer is required to lead and direct the workforce, including agency and subcontractor staff on site, to ensure safety, productivity and workmanship meet the necessary standards.

**The role**

As the Senior Signalling Installer, you will be responsible for checking and monitoring the quality of installation works, as well as ensuring all staff work safely and efficiently, while at the same time liaising with all departments and contractors toensure work is carried out to standard and within the allotted timescales. With a thorough knowledge of the rules and regulations of railway workings you will be required to undertake the role of Site Supervisor when required.

**Responsibilities**:
Leading and directing a team, ensuring acceptable productivity and workmanship of all the team members which may include Agency / Sub-Contractors on site. Ensuring that all work complies with current quality and group / line standards
- Ensuring productivity and workmanship of staff is of an acceptable standard
- Ensuring all site operations are carried out safely, and in accordance with standards, reporting on accidents and near misses if required
- Assisting in the planning of on site operations, and future projects
- Ensuring all relevant site records and paperwork are completed, and left in a correct and orderly state
- Undertaking ES, COSS, and PC duties as required, together with other relevant safety duties / briefs

**Essential experience**
- Thorough knowledge of signalling equipment
- Thorough knowledge of rules and regulations of railway working
- S&T work experience
- IRSE Licensed or working towards
- Ability to lead staff
- Signalling modules SMTH, Mod 3C, Mod 5 desirable
- PTS, COSS and PC desirable
- Good mechanical skills, and good electrical knowledge
- Ability to use hand and power tools
- Able to drive or willing to learn
- Must be fully flexible to workdays, evenings, nights, and weekends
- Must be willing to undergo pre-employment screening (including, but not limited to credit check, personal and employment references, qualification checks and a drugs & alcohol and medical assessment)
